首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

什么是良好的WCF/Web服务安全性阅读?

良好的WCF/Web服务安全性阅读是指在WCF(Windows Communication Foundation)或Web服务应用程序中,遵循一系列最佳实践和安全策略,以确保数据的保密性、完整性和可用性。以下是一些建议的阅读材料,可以帮助您了解如何保护WCF/Web服务的安全性:

  1. WCF安全编程:这本书详细介绍了WCF中的安全功能,包括身份验证、授权、数据保密性和数据完整性。
  2. Web服务安全:这篇文章讨论了Web服务中的常见安全问题,以及如何使用一些常见的安全机制(如HTTPS、加密和身份验证)来保护Web服务。
  3. WCF安全指南:这是一份详细的WCF安全指南,涵盖了从身份验证到授权的各个方面,以及如何使用WCF的内置安全功能来保护您的应用程序。
  4. Web服务安全最佳实践:这篇文章介绍了一些Web服务安全的最佳实践,包括使用HTTPS、加密敏感数据、限制访问权限等。
  5. WCF安全性概述:这篇文章提供了WCF安全性的概述,包括一些常见的安全威胁和如何使用WCF的安全功能来防止这些威胁。
  6. Web服务安全框架:这是一个关于Web服务安全框架的概述,包括一些常见的安全威胁和如何使用该框架来保护您的Web服务。

在阅读这些资源时,请注意,您可能需要根据您的具体需求和环境进行一些调整。此外,请确保始终关注最新的安全更新和补丁,以确保您的应用程序始终受到最佳保护。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

什么 RESTful Web服务

背景 本文简述了什么 RESTful Web服务 REST 和 RESTful Representational State Transfer (缩写:REST)直译就是表现层状态转换,它是一种便于不同软件...符合这种架构风格网络服务 可被称为 RESTful 风格。...4、操作结果表现:资源表现形式可以是JSON,XML或者HTML等; 5、无状态:客户端与服务端之间交互在请求之间无状态,从客户端到服务每个请求都必须包含理解请求所必需信息。...明确方法指HTTPget,post方法; 清晰资源指一个语义表达清晰网址; 不同资源表现形式指导致了资源状态变化。...即: 看到 URI 就知道要资源什么 (是什么) 看到 HTTP 方法 就知道干什么 (怎么做) 看到 HTTP 响应,就知道结果如何 (结果如何) 示例 用示例表示。

2.9K30

WCF技术剖析之二十: 服务WCF体系中如何被描述?

任何一个程序都需要运行于一个确定进程中,进程一个容器,其中包含程序实例运行所需资源。同理,一个WCF服务监听与执行同样需要通过一个进程来承载。...服务寄宿方式大体分两种:一种为一组WCF服务创建一个托管应用程序,通过手工启动程序方式对服务进行寄宿,所有的托管应用程序均可作为WCF服务宿主,比如Console应用、Windows Forms...服务寄宿手段为一个WCF服务类型创建一个ServiceHost对象(或者任何继承于ServiceHostBase对象)。...客户端行为体现WCF如何进行服务调用方式,而服务端行为则体现了WCF请求分发方式。...行为WCF进行扩展最为重要方式,按照行为作用域不同,WCF行为大体包含以下四种: 服务行为(Service Behavior):基于服务本身行为,实现了接口System.ServiceModel.Description.IServiceBehavior

96860

Web 应用安全性: 浏览器如何工作

浏览器一个渲染引擎,它工作下载一个web页面,并以人类能够理解方式渲染它。 虽然这几乎一种过于简单过分简化,但我们现在需要知道全部内容。 用户在浏览器栏中输入一个地址。...服务器让我们知道请求是成功(200 OK),并向响应中添加一些头部信息,例如,它告知哪个服务器处理了我们请求(Server:gws),该响应 X-XSS-Protection 策略是什么,等等。...最终结果普通人能够理解: 如果想要更详细地了解当我们在浏览器地址栏中按回车键时会发生什么,建议阅读“What happens when…”,这是一个非常精细尝试来解释该过程背后机制。...W3C标准开发主体,但是浏览器开发自己特性并最终成为 web 标准情况并不少见,安全性也不例外。...这告诉我们两件事: Safari似乎并不关心用户安全性(开玩笑:Safari 12中将提供SameSite cookie,这可能在你阅读本文时已经发布) 修补一个浏览器上漏洞并不意味着所有用户都是安全

59330

什么Web 服务器 以及 应用服务

因为其主要支持协议 HTTP,所以一定程度上, HTTP 服务器和 WEB 服务相等。应用程序服务器“作为服务器执行共享业务应用程序底层系统软件” 这是 MS 对其定义。...Apache & TomcatApache其在 WEB 服务器中,纯粹 WEB 服务器,常与 Tomcat 搭配使用。...虽然整合会带来相关问题,但是这种方式最为有效。Tomcat与Web服务器Tomcat提供一个支持Servlet和JSP运行容器。Servlet和JSP能根据实时需要,产生动态网页内容。...通俗讲,Web服务器传送(serves)页面使浏览器可以浏览,然而应用程序服务器提供客户端应用程序可以调用(call)方法(methods)。...但是,不能将Tomcat和Apache HTTP服务器混淆,Apache HTTP服务用C语言实现HTTPWeb服务器;这两个HTTP web server不是捆绑在一起

23000

亚马逊Web服务如何成功

这并非一种IaaS,而是超越了IaaS之上:平台服务。 平台服务将传统OS和中间件中高价值应用元素抽离出来,将其放到Web服务中,这项服务则可以让任何应用在IaaS之上运作。...AWS将平台服务带入下一个阶段 然而,紧随着微软PaaS失败而来占据云领导地位亚马逊Web服务(AWS)将平台服务带到一个全新且刺激方向,即承诺真正面向云应用。...和Kinesis,以及虚拟桌面、高速缓存,甚至Web优化服务。...这样厂商即便保留有市场,包括且有其微软这样厂商,可能必须提出其目前中间件即系列分布式Web服务,而非作为一个完整平台,才能够更易于与亚马逊竞争。...在平台服务中解决“API爆炸”风险平台服务逐渐深入关键所在。最佳策略就是从平台服务尽可能隔离应用请求,以便提供商能够没有较大影响作出改变。

72460

什么web标准以及web标准构成_web标准理解

大家好,又见面了,我你们朋友全栈君。 web标准 不是某一个标准,而是一系列标准集合。...这些标准大部分由万维网联盟(外语缩写:W3C)起草和发布,也有一些其他标准组织制订标准,比如ECMA(European Computer Manufacturers Association)ECMAScript...上述百度对web标准描述。 Web标准,使得Web开发更加容易。 简单来说web标准可以分为结构(html),表现(css)和行为(JavaScript)。...行为指的是页面与用户具有一定交互,主要是有js组成。 为什么要有web 标准? 对于浏览器开发商和 Web 程序开发人员在开发新应用程序时遵守指定标准更有利于 Web 更好地发展。...博主个人简述: 如果你了解html历史,你就会知道 在从html1~5,这期间经历了漫长浏览器战争,在战争中每个浏览器都想称霸世界,都在不断增加自己专用扩展包,受害web开发人员,因为你要针对不同浏览器你单独写

1.7K20

用IIS建立高安全性Web服务方法

修改共享权限 建立新共享后立即修改Everyone缺省权限,不让Web服务器访问者得到不必要权限。 4. 为系统管理员账号更名,避免非法用户攻击。...保证IIS自身安全性 IIS安全安装 要构建一个安全IIS服务器,必须从安装时就充分考虑安全问题。 1. 不要将IIS安装在系统分区上。 2. 修改IIS安装默认路径。 3....为IIS中文件分类设置权限 除了在操作系统里为IIS文件设置必要权限外,还要在IIS管理器中为它们设置权限。一个好设置策略:为Web 站点上不同类型文件都建立目录,然后给它们分配适当权限。...保护日志安全 日志系统安全策略一个重要环节,确保日志安全能有效提高系统整体安全性。...通过以上一些安全设置,相信你Web服务器会安全许多。

1.1K20

什么说 WASM Web 未来?

什么说 WASM Web 未来? 这篇文章打算讲什么?...了解 WebAssembly 前世今生,这一致力于让 Web 更广泛使用伟大创造如何在整个 Web/Node.js 生命周期起作用,探讨为什么 WASM Web 未来?...这两步整个代码执行过程中最耗费时间两步,这也是为什么 JavaScript 语言背景下,Web 无法执行一些高性能应用,如大型游戏、视频剪辑等。...HTML,需要在本地起一个服务器,因为单纯打开通过 file:// 协议访问时,主流浏览器不支持 XHR 请求,只有在 HTTP 服务器下,才能进行 XHR 请求,所以我们运行如下命令来打开网站:...正如 Docker 创始人所说: “ 如果 WASM+WASI 在 2008 年就出现的话,那么就不需要创造 Docker 了,服务器上 WASM 计算未来,我们期待已久标准化系统接口。

1K30

WCF系统内置绑定列表与系统绑定所支持功能

WCF系统内置绑定列表 绑定 配置元素 说明 传输协议 编码格式 BasicHttpBinding 一个绑定,适用于与符合 WS-Basic ProfileWeb...服务(例如基于 ASP.NET Web 服务(ASMX)服务)进行通信。...此绑定使用HTTP作为传输协议,并使用文本/XML作为默认消息编码 HTTP/HTTPS Text,MTOM WSHttpBinding 一个安全且可互操作绑定,适合于非双工服务约定...并支持联合安全性 HTTP/HTTPS Text,MTOM NetTcpBinding 一个安全且经过优化绑定,适用于WCF应用程序之间跨计算机通信 TCP Binary...良好 √ √ wsHttpBinding √ √ √ √ √ 良好 √ √ wsDualHttpBinding √ √ √ √ √ 良好 √ √ √ netTcpBinding √ √ √

62510

WCF安全指南

通过这一规定性指南文档(其中包括指南、常见问题回答、最佳实践), 你可以一目了然地获知如何你WCF服务安全性。...本篇指南patterns & practices、WCF团队成员以及行业专家共同协作成果。...通过本篇指南,可以了解到WCF安全性,如何为服务通信设计提供授权和认证,提供了使用WCF进行通用分布式应用开发解决方案模式,同时还给出了改善服务安全因素原则、模式与实践。...安全基础 2、Web Services威胁与应对 3、Web Services安全设计指南 4、WCF安全基础 5、WCF授权、认证与身份 6、WCF模拟与委托 7、消息与传输安全 8、绑定...MSDN在线阅读: WCF安全指南CodePlex站点: http://www.codeplex.com/WCFSecurityGuide WCF安全指南MSDN文档:http://msdn.microsoft.com

48460

Web标准安全性研究:对某数字货币服务授权渗透

表面下,现代Web只有通过不断增长技术标准才能实现。标准旨在管理技术和数据互操作性。Web标准是最广泛采用和快速发展标准之一,其变化也经常引起浏览器供应商,Web开发人员和用户之间激烈争论。...在这篇博文中,我们将详细说明盲目遵从明确定义且普遍采用Web标准所带来危害。我们将对一个知名数字货币服务发动远程攻击,并”窃取其中所有的货币“以此来证明我们观点可靠性。...通过扩展,在给定网站上发布任何JavaScript都由本地计算机上Web浏览器执行。这意味着远程发起和恶意编写JavaScript可能会被用于在本地主机服务上进行探测。...我们可以通过创建一个恶意网站来测试这一理论,该网站试图从他们本地守护进程中请求受害者钱包种子: ? 但是我们请求被阻止了!发生了什么? 显然,想通过浏览器攻击本地主机服务并不容易。...这就是为什么上面描述用户代理过滤方法看起来安全原因。User-Agent不在白名单中,因此无法设置为跨域请求。

1.7K40

C# WCF服务

1:什么WCFWCF(Windows Communication Foundation)由微软开发一系列支持数据通信应用程序框架,可以翻译为Windows 通讯开发平台。...WCF平台有时也被称为服务模型。WCF基本特征互操作性。这是微软用于构建面向服务应用程序最新技术之一。...简单归结为四大部分 网络服务协议,即用什么网络协议开放客户端接入。 业务服务协议,即声明服务提供哪些业务。 数据类型声明,即对客户端与服务器端通信数据部分进行一致化。 传输安全性相关定义。...通信双方沟通方式,由合约来订定。通信双方所遵循通信方法,由协议绑定来订定。通信期间安全性,由双方约定安全性层次来订定。 3:WCF什么优势 1:互操作性。...4:WCFWeb服务什么区别 属性:WCF服务通过定义ServiceContract和OperationContract属性,而在Web服务,WebService和WebMethod属性用于定义相同

89320

WCF技术剖析(卷1)之推荐序

资深架构师 曲春雨 2009年6月 于北京 【推荐序二】 随着核心Web服务标准(SOAP和WSDL)逐渐被广泛采纳和应用,高度异构软件系统之间互操作性取得了前所未有的进步,同时也在安全性、事务性...、可靠性方面提出了新要求,以至于后来又推出了大量Web服务补充标准。...在.NET平台下做过分布式开发朋友,想必对以下技术都不会陌生:ASP.NET服务Web服务增强、.NET Remoting、MSMQ等,这些技术各自独立,编程模型差别较大,无法用一种统一编程模型进行分布式应用程序开发...在2003年时,微软启动了一个代码名为Indigo项目,微软试图实现一个宏伟计划,用一套统一API完成上述各模型功能,同时支持良好扩展性,便于出现新Web服务标准、协议时,无需再开发另外一套模型...目前WCF技术已经得到了广泛应用,但国内在这方面的资料却非常少,据我所知,迄今为止还没有一本WCF原创中文书籍,ArtechWCF技术剖析》国内第一本,非常荣幸,我能在第一时间阅读本书书稿,本书内容涵盖了

735110

什么 Web3 游戏未来

Web3 在早期发展速度比互联网还快。如果这一趋势持续下去,我们预计今天用户将达到 2 亿,到 2027 年将达到 10 亿。但是所有用户都来自哪里?他们在 web3 中做什么?...最重要:他们为什么来?给忙碌的人总结web3 未来光明web3 游戏正在引领潮流。区块链技术可以改变游戏玩法。...除了加密货币和金融业,采用 web3 主导力量之一游戏业。根据区块链游戏联盟 2021 年成员调查和报告,大约一半区块链使用量。...然而,Coda Labs 研究表明,只有 3% 游戏玩家拥有 NFT。这告诉我们游戏行业未来潜力是什么?会发生什么?让我们深入了解区块链游戏未来。...Minecraft,PlayStation 商店,2022 年那么,总而言之,这意味着什么Web3 游戏未来NFT 一种新技术。

43330

如何配置php.ini以提高Web服务安全性

对于PHP服务器模块版本,仅在启动Web服务器时才发生一次。对于CGI和CLI版本,它会在每次调用时发生。...如何配置php.ini以提高Web服务安全性 1、禁用不需要PHP函数 此选项可以设置禁止使用哪些PHP函数。 PHP中某些功能仍然存在很大风险。...,shell_exec,proc_open,proc_get_status 注意:如果您服务器包含一些用于CentOS系统状态检测PHP程序,请不要禁用shell_exec,proc_open,proc_get_status...如果您PHP脚本确实需要很长执行时间,则可以适当地增加此时间设置。 3、PHP脚本内存使用情况 memory_limit = 8M 此选项指定PHP脚本处理可以占用最大内存。默认值为8MB。...如果服务器内存大于1GB,则可以将此选项设置为12MB,以提高PHP脚本处理效率。

69120

WCF服务部署到IIS上,然后通过web服务引用方式出现错误解决办法

如果该服务已在当前解决方案中定义,请尝试生成该解决方案,然后再次添加服务引用。 该错误在使用svcutil生成client代码时报错误,服务部署在IIS7上,部署过程都是完全教科书式进行。...经过一轮谷百之后,发现网上有很多类似的情况,有的说是因为用了wsHttpBinding协议引起,或者元数据没有正确公开,但都不是他们说情况。后来找到了一篇文章,说添加WCF引用一个陷阱。...web服务引用方式出现错误解决办法;如果wcf服务没有托管在IIS上,只是在本地浏览方式托管后通过web服务引用方式没有这样问题。...问题描述这样。 1、通过vs自带wcf服务DEMO,发布到IIS 上去时候,通过web服务引用时候出错。 ?...2、WCF客户端通过web服务引用时候,http://10.198.1.21:8089/Service1.svc 一直无法正常添加引用。 ?

1.4K10

个人web服务器搭建教程_服务干嘛

我们用右键单击“我电脑”选“管理”,在“计算机管理”窗口里展开“服务和应用程序”然后点选“Internet信息服务”在窗口右边,我们可以看到“默认 Web站点”并且其“状况”“正在运行”;“主机头名...又弹出一个“默认 Web站点 属性”窗口。在这里你必须小心,不要乱修改里面的任何属性,除非你有把握修改对你有益。...我们先把“Web站点”页“说明”改掉,原来“默认 Web站点”说明改成你自己站点名称。然后我们点选“主目录”页,把“本地路径”也修改掉,点“浏览”,然后选择你网站所在目录。...安装完毕后(大家要注意了,如果你机器安装了邮件检测类防病毒软件就要把它关掉了,因为会引起端口冲突SMTP用25端口POP用110端口)自动打开程序,我们先点击“设置”按钮,在服务框里选你要作为什么服务器运行...这次要介绍方法所用拨号软件Enternet 300,为什么要用这软件呢?

3K20

Web服务器做了什么以及实现一个Web服务难度

Web服务器会做些什么? (1) 建立连接——接受一个客户端连接,或者如果不希望与这个客户端建立连接,就将其关闭。 (2) 接收请求——从网络中读取一条 HTTP 请求报文。...一个高性能Web服务器能够支持上万条连接。通过这些连接,可以快速接受客户端请求以及返回服务响应。随着时代发展,Apache服务器不再高性能代名词,现在主流都变成了Nginx服务器。...Nginx采用了多进程+异步非阻塞IO方式来支持高性能。其次,处理请求,也就是识别HTTP报文。由于HTTP一个文本协议,看起来挺简单,实际上HTTP协议是非常复杂。...需要服务器能够准确解析HTTP报文。最后,Web服务器需要连接到复杂后端应用程序上,Web 服务器要能够分辨出资源什么时候动态,动态内容生成程序位于何处,以及如何运行那个程序。...Nginx这样Web服务核心代码已经超过了10W行。因此,实现一个真正可用Web服务器不是那么简单一件事情。

73520

菜菜从零学习WCF一(WCF概述)

菜菜刚开始接触WCF,一切都要从零开始,所以在此也记下笔记,以作日后翻看,大家也可以多多指点。   在了解WCF概述之前,我们也先来了解一下,在WCF版本还未进行发布之前,都是使用什么技术呢?...,WSE就可提供更加灵活Web服务安全性。...性能大多是业务中至关重要考虑事项,开发WCF目标就是要使之成为Microsoft所开发速度最快分布式应用程序平台之一。   ...WCF支持一个大WS_*规范集,因此可在同样支持这些规范任何其他平台进行通信时帮助提供可靠性、安全性和事务。   ...那么到此第一个WCF服务创建到调用就实现了。 第一课我主要了解了什么WCF服务,以及创建了最简单WCF服务

1.3K20
领券